India Hydroelectric Power Market Overview
Base Year: 2024
Historical Years: 2019-2024
Forecast Years: 2025-2033
Market Size in 2024: 50.00 GW
Market Forecast in 2033: 56.16 GW
Market Growth Rate: 1.30% (2025-2033)
The India hydroelectric power market size was valued at 50.00 GW in 2024 and is expected to reach 56.16 GW by 2033,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 1.30% during 2025-2033.
India Hydroelectric Power Market Trends:
The Indian hydroelectric marketplace is now in full ferment, with an ongoing raft of newer technologies and shifting energy priorities fuelling faster development. Some major trends involve major overhauls for old hydropower infrastructure, whereby many utilities now utilize digital systems for monitoring and employ predictive maintenance methods to minimize downtime and maximize efficiency. Decreasingly, especially in hilly terrains, so small and micro hydropower projects gain momentum as decentralized energy has become more favored by policy. Secondly, of late, integrating hydropower into renewable energy grids is getting more relevance, with pump storage being touted as a balancing mechanism for intermittences of solar and wind power. Further, SIA has become a foremost consideration, with sustainable development practices now bearing on project approvals and strategies for community engagement.
Essentially, PPPs are entering to speed up projects by pooling government resources with private sector expertise to circumvent the usual issues of financing and logistics. Innovations have been introduced in turbine designs that increase energy production and decrease environmental impacts, especially in low-head and run-of-river projects. Meanwhile, there is a greater push toward hybrid energy systems where hydropower facilities compliment other renewables to ensure grid stability and energy security.
